概括
亚洲大米 (Oryza sativa L.) 的化涉及多个来源. 虽然大多数精选的基因起源于中国,但很大一部分来自南亚和东南亚,这表明复杂的化事件.

背景情况:
- 化亚洲大米 (Oryza sativa L.) 的起源是一个长期存在的争论.
- 关键假设包括在中国发生的单一养事件与在不同地区发生的多个事件.
- 这些假设预测了与化相关的基因的不同进化历史.
研究的目的:
- 为了研究亚洲养大米的地理起源和进化历史.
- 为了解决单个与多个化事件之间的争论.
- 为了识别在米化过程中选择的基因和等位基因.
主要方法:
- 收集了1578个重新排序的亚洲大米基因组的大数据集.
- 包括其整个地理范围的野生大米扩展样本.
- 分析了选定的基因并构建了家族遗传树来推断起源.
主要成果:
- 鉴定了993个参与养大米的精选基因.
- 遗传学分析表明,日本和印加大米形成了一个单种群.
- 约80%的精选基因的化等位基因起源于中国.
- 相当少数 (约20%) 的化等位基因起源于南亚和东南亚的野生大米.
结论:
- 亚洲大米的化并不是单一的事件,而是涉及多个地理来源.
- 有证据表明,中国有主要的化中心,南亚和东南亚有次要的化中心.
- 这一发现澄清了Oryza sativa L.复杂的进化轨迹.
